BASIC OPERATION

CHECK CURRENT POSITION

The button on this screen searches for information on the
current position (if there is no GPS reception it uses the last
confirmed position) and recommended spots in the area,
and displays them on the screen.
1.
Select "street name" on the map screen.
2.
Check that the "Where Am I? (Where Am I?)" screen is
displayed.

No.
Information/Function
Latitude/Longitude (Current positional coordinates use
the WGS84 land survey system)
Altitude (Advanced information acquired by the GPS
receiver - may not be accurate)
The latest location information is displayed, or the time
after the latest information was acquired is displayed.
A detailed address (when available) for the current
position is displayed at the bottom of the screen.
Address of current position on left
Address of current position on right
Select to save the current position in the destination list.
(→P.235)
Select to search for nearby help around the current
position. (→P.218)
